First, at the height of the severe recession, a lot of people were attracted to it as a way to make some real money. I'm among them.
But you soon learn the economics don't work. A very few people made some real money in the early days selling virtual land, but that collapsed pretty fast. You have to buy the virtual currency with real money, but the exchange rate always was stupid and the virtual market did not sustain selling huge quantities of something just to make small amounts of real dollars.
Second, the author of the posted article only brushes quickly past the XXX sexual garbage that infests SL. Literally any form of sheer depravity is practiced in virtual form. Pedophilia, rape, bestiality, BDSM, grotesquely sized and misshapen male and female body parts. Linden Lab tried to segregate the deeply pornographic aspects, but in truth, that's what sustains the platform.
Third, Linden Lab failed to keep up graphically. Today's video games are incredibly beautiful graphically, while SL is still blocky, laggy 2005 technology.
Fourth, the explosive growth of online games with really excellent offerings are like comparing a modern car to a Model T.
